Solicitation and prostitution are considered misdemeanor offenses in Michigan; a second offense will result in increased criminal penalties. Those convicted of solicitation or prostitution will face a maximum fine of up to $500, up to 93 days in jail, or both.

Michigan law requires organizations to register with the Department of Attorney General if they solicit and receive charitable contributions in Michigan. Most charities that solicit contributions in Michigan are required to file one.
